Easy ways to save energy in your home:
1) Find better ways to heat and cool your home.
*Use ceiling fans instead of air conditioning
*Replace air filters in air conditioners and heaters
*Install a programmable thermostat
2) Use Daylighting! Daylighting is the practice of using natural light to heat & cool your home. Allow the sun to come in during the day to heat your home in the winter. Open your winters during cool summer nights. In the morning, close the winters and blinds, holding the cool air inside
3) Cook Smarter. Use lids for faster heating time; Convection ovens use less energy then conventional. Microwaves use 80% less energy than conventional ovens; use top rack in the oven as it will cook faster and is hotter.
4) Change the way you do the laundry. Clean the lint trap every time; wait till you have a full load of clothing; avoid high temperature settings, Air dry clothing whenever possible.
